Trolley

The Mesabi Railway transports visitors by trolley from the main park to the site of the former mining community known as Glen Location. Round trip, the railroad runs 2.5 miles along the edge of the Glen mine. Spectacular vistas show off the man-made canyon whose steep walls plunge down hundreds of feet to a pit now filled with cold spring water.

The original Mesabi Railway line served thousands of Iron Range residents daily. It ran 36 miles from Gilbert to Hibbing and operated from 1912 to 1927.

Ironworld's two trolleys, the Glen and Mesaba, are both 1928 W-2 class Melbourne trolleys with a capacity of 60 people each.

The trolley opens for the season in May, weather permitting. Official opening day is Memorial Day. The trolley runs throughout the day Tuesday through Sunday, until Labor Day, when operations are restricted to weekends, weather permitting.
